Mile High United Way announced a $7 million investment in the seven counties in which they operate. The investment will allow Mile High United Way’s partner organizations to leverage resources to ensure its most vulnerable community members are getting connected to the resources they need, including child care, housing and basic needs. Learn more about the investment.

Last month, Western Governor’s University (WGU) awarded its 5,280th degree in Colorado. The graduate, Mark Dimalanta, received his Master of Business Administration. To mark the occasion, WGU will select 25 students for the 5,280 Milestone Scholarship, which will award up to $132,000. Congratulations, WGU!
